Modernization and Efficiency Gains

The workforce changes reflect a shift toward performance-based management. Federal agencies have increasingly integrated cloud systems, artificial intelligence tools, and digital processing, which reduce the need for large staff numbers for routine administrative tasks. By right-sizing teams, the government is able to operate more efficiently without compromising core service delivery.

Leadership emphasizes that reducing unnecessary positions helps focus personnel on strategic priorities. According to OPM Director Scott Kupor, these reforms enhance accountability, promote excellence, and reward employees who demonstrate results-driven performance. The approach mirrors private-sector practices where staffing is aligned with productivity gains, ensuring both effectiveness and cost control.

Trump’s public remarks reinforce this narrative, emphasizing that streamlining workforce structures strengthens operations while delivering value to taxpayers. Supporters argue that leaner agencies equipped with modern tools are more agile, responsive, and capable of addressing public needs in a timely manner.
